Yes! What i can immediately tell you is to raise your humidity to roughly 75% ish to 90% rh. The 50% will work for flowering, its actually perfect for flowering. This is because the new clones dont actually take up water till around a week after they've been planted. Their source of water is strictly through the leaves. This means they will most likely begin to wilt or die off. And the VPD is a bit too high for new babies. Usually I keep my clones at a 0.4 to 0.7 kPa. So if they are under heavy lights turn them down a touch, 20% power is my sweet spot. Raise humidity and if they fit id use an old 2 litre bottle, cut it up to make a mega dome almost like people do with seedlings just on a larger scale. And never spray or water the clone directly till roots begin to form, it will rot or cause them to mold.

From what ive experienced, yes. During flowering. It helps transpiration or something if you use a grow tent with decent air circulation to reduce dead zones and heat spots. As long as you aren't completely sealing them they seem to enjoy it. If you are growing in a room without airflow its a great way to stunt growth and promote mold growth instead. When I flower, I prefer to be around 45 to 50rh with as much light as possible without burning the plant. This will almost entirely reduce the possibility of bud rot. But dont take it from me, im pretty new and have only grown 4 or 5 plants. All of which I had at about 85 Fahrenheit and 65 to 70 rh during both seedling and veg.
